Common questions
Will the AI rewrite my prose?
No. Polish fixes recognition errors and punctuation while preserving every meaningful word you said. It never paraphrases or "improves" your writing - that part stays yours.
Can I dictate offline and upload later?
Yes. Record voice memos on any device and upload MP3, WAV, M4A, or MP4 files up to 2 hours long. A 30-minute file is typically transcribed in 1-2 minutes.
What export formats do writers get?
TXT, Markdown, and SRT on every plan. Pro adds PDF and Word exports, which paste cleanly into Scrivener, Google Docs, and editorial workflows.
